diff --git a/src/hooks/useLifeHandler.hook.ts b/src/hooks/useLifeHandler.hook.ts index 2412a79a..d17184d0 100644 --- a/src/hooks/useLifeHandler.hook.ts +++ b/src/hooks/useLifeHandler.hook.ts @@ -48,10 +48,10 @@ export const useLifeHandler = (chartConfig: CreateComponentType | CreateComponen try { return new Function(` return ( - async function(mouseEvent){ + async function(components,mouseEvent){ ${fnStr} } - )`)() + )`)().bind(undefined,components) } catch (error) { console.error(error) } diff --git a/src/views/chart/ContentConfigurations/components/ChartEvent/components/ChartEventBaseHandle/index.vue b/src/views/chart/ContentConfigurations/components/ChartEvent/components/ChartEventBaseHandle/index.vue index cc2a7525..81ac710f 100644 --- a/src/views/chart/ContentConfigurations/components/ChartEvent/components/ChartEventBaseHandle/index.vue +++ b/src/views/chart/ContentConfigurations/components/ChartEvent/components/ChartEventBaseHandle/index.vue @@ -16,7 +16,7 @@

// {{ EventTypeName[eventName] }}
- async {{ eventName }} (mouseEvent) { + async {{ eventName }} (mouseEvent,components) {

@@ -52,7 +52,7 @@

async function    - {{ eventName }}(mouseEvent)  { + {{ eventName }}(mouseEvent,components)  {